Jadi, orang-orang yang mengembangkan database untuk mencari nafkah adalah sumber daya yang penting bagi pengguna biasa, bagi “pengguna yang kuat”, dan juga bagi produsen perangkat lunak. Berikut adalah kompilasi dari beberapa saran terbaik yang dikumpulkan dari daftar panjang pakar Access. Mengetahui bahwa mereka menawarkan saran untuk pengguna baru, mereka menawarkan saran yang sesuai dengan kebutuhan Anda dan untuk membantu memastikan bahwa Anda benar-benar dapat menggunakan Access dengan percaya diri dan efektif. Pada saat Anda selesai, Anda akan memberikan upaya Anda jumlah perencanaan dan pengorganisasian yang tepat — dan Anda akan memiliki rencana yang solid untuk bergerak maju dengan pengembangan dan penggunaan database yang Anda buat dengan Access.
Jadi, inilah saran bijak — dalam sepuluh gigitan cepat.
Dokumentasikan semuanya seolah-olah suatu hari Anda akan ditanyai oleh FBI
Jangan berhemat pada waktu yang dihabiskan untuk mendokumentasikan database Anda. Mengapa? Karena Anda akan senang nanti karena Anda tidak berhemat. Anda akan memiliki semua rencana Anda, informasi umum Anda, dan semua ide Anda — yang Anda tindak lanjuti dan yang tersisa di papan gambar — siap saat berikutnya Anda perlu membangun database. Anda juga akan memilikinya untuk merujuk kapan atau jika ada yang tidak beres dengan database Anda saat ini. Anda tidak sengaja menghapus kueri yang disimpan? Tidak masalah. Lihat dokumentasi Anda. Lupa bagaimana tabel Anda terkait? Periksa dokumentasi dan bangun kembali hubungan. Perlu menjelaskan kepada seseorang mengapa atau bagaimana Anda mengatur sesuatu? Lihat catatan Anda dan buat mereka kagum dengan pemikiran ke depan dan pertimbangan yang cermat.
Jadi, apa yang harus disertakan dalam dokumentasi yang luar biasa ini? Yah, semuanya. Tapi inilah daftar untuk Anda mulai:
- Informasi umum tentang database:
- Lokasi file/data (dengan jalur jaringan atau URL Internet tertentu)
- Penjelasan tentang apa yang dilakukan database
- Informasi tentang cara kerjanya
- Tata letak tabel:
- Sertakan nama bidang, ukuran, konten, dan konten sampel.
- Jika beberapa data berasal dari sumber esoteris atau sementara (misalnya, data kartu kredit yang Anda unduh setiap bulan secara online), catat fakta tersebut dalam dokumentasi.
- Ringkasan laporan:
- Nama laporan
- Penjelasan informasi dalam laporan
Jika Anda perlu menjalankan beberapa kueri sebelum membuat laporan, dokumentasikan prosesnya. (Lebih baik lagi, dapatkan nerd yang ramah untuk membantu Anda mengotomatiskan pekerjaan.)
- Kueri dan logika: Untuk setiap kueri, berikan penjelasan mendetail tentang cara kerja kueri, terutama jika melibatkan beberapa tabel atau sumber data di luar Access (seperti tabel SQL atau area penyimpanan informasi besar lainnya).
- Jawab pertanyaan “Mengapa?”: Saat Anda mendokumentasikan database Anda, fokuslah pada mengapa desain Anda bekerja dengan cara kerjanya. Mengapa kueri menggunakan tabel tertentu itu? Memang, jika Anda bekerja di lingkungan perusahaan, Anda mungkin tidak tahu mengapa sistem bekerja seperti itu, tetapi tidak ada salahnya untuk bertanya.
- Detail pemulihan bencana:
- Proses dan jadwal pencadangan
- Di mana cadangan berada (Anda ada membuat cadangan, kan?) dan cara mengembalikan file yang dicadangkan
- Apa yang harus dilakukan jika database berhenti bekerja
Jika database Anda menjalankan fungsi organisasi yang penting — seperti akuntansi, inventaris, manajemen kontak, atau entri pesanan — pastikan bahwa proses manual ada untuk menjaga organisasi tetap berjalan jika database tidak berfungsi — dan ingat untuk mendokumentasikan prosesnya!
Jika Anda memerlukan bantuan dengan salah satu item ini, tanyakan pada seseorang! Apakah Anda meminjam seseorang dari departemen Teknologi Informasi Anda atau menyewa ahli komputer, dapatkan bantuan yang Anda butuhkan. Perlakukan dokumentasi Anda seperti asuransi — organisasi tidak boleh berjalan tanpanya.Setiap 6 hingga 12 bulan, tinjau dokumentasi Anda untuk melihat apakah pembaruan diperlukan. Dokumentasi hanya berguna jika mutakhir dan jika orang lain selain Anda dapat memahaminya. Demikian juga, pastikan Anda (atau rekan kerja Anda di kantor) mengetahui di mana letak dokumentasi. Jika Anda memiliki versi elektronik, simpan cadangannya dan siapkan cetakannya — sesuatu yang Anda akan senang melakukannya jika Anda atau orang lain mencoba mendaur ulang komponen database Anda menggunakan fitur Bagian Aplikasi.
Jaga bidang database Access Anda sekecil mungkin
Saat Anda membuat tabel, buat bidang teks Anda dengan ukuran yang sesuai untuk data yang Anda simpan di dalamnya. Secara default, Access menyetel bidang teks (dikenal sebagai Teks Pendek) untuk menampung 255 karakter — pengaturan yang cukup murah hati, terutama jika bidang tersebut berisi singkatan status dua huruf yang sangat sedikit.
Seratus atau lebih ruang ekstra — yang tidak digunakan di sebagian besar bidang teks — tidak akan tampak seperti apa pun untuk tidur, tetapi kalikan ruang itu di seluruh tabel dengan 100.000 alamat pelanggan di dalamnya, dan Anda akan mendapatkan banyak megabyte penyimpanan ruang yang sangat sibuk menahan apa-apa.
Sesuaikan ukuran bidang dengan pengaturan Ukuran Bidang pada tab Umum dalam tampilan Desain.
Gunakan bidang angka untuk bilangan real di database Access
Gunakan kolom angka untuk angka yang digunakan dalam perhitungan, bukan untuk teks yang berpura-pura menjadi angka. Aplikasi perangkat lunak merasakan perbedaan besar antara kode pos 47999 dan nomor 47.999. Aplikasi melihat kode pos sebagai rangkaian karakter yang semuanya berupa angka, tetapi angka diperlakukan sebagai angka aktual yang dapat Anda gunakan untuk matematika dan semua jenis hal numerik menyenangkan lainnya. Alasan lain mengapa kode pos bukan bidang Angka? Jika Anda berada di A.S. dan kode pos Anda dimulai dengan nol, aplikasi memotong angka nol di depan dan hanya menyimpan angka bukan nol di bidang – 01234 menjadi 1234. Tidak bagus!Saat memilih jenis untuk bidang baru dengan angka di dalamnya, tanyakan pada diri Anda pertanyaan sederhana:Apakah Anda akan membuat perhitungan atau melakukan sesuatu yang berhubungan dengan matematika dengan bidang itu?
- Jika Anda akan menghitung dengan bidang, gunakan Angka ketik.
- Jika Anda tidak akan menghitung dengan bidang, simpan bidang sebagai Teks Singkat .
Validasi data Akses Anda
Validasi dapat membantu mencegah data buruk mendekati tabel Anda. Validasi mudah dibuat, cepat disiapkan, dan selalu waspada (bahkan ketika Anda sangat lelah sehingga Anda tidak dapat melihat lurus). Jika Anda tidak menggunakan validasi untuk melindungi integritas database Anda, Anda harus benar-benar memulai.Gunakan nama yang mudah dipahami di Access agar semuanya tetap sederhana
Saat membuat tabel atau membuat database, pikirkan tentang file database, bidang, dan nama tabel yang Anda gunakan:- Apakah Anda ingat apa arti nama tiga bulan dari sekarang? Enam bulan dari sekarang?
- Apakah nama tersebut cukup intuitif sehingga orang lain dapat melihat tabel dan mencari tahu apa fungsinya, lama setelah Anda beralih ke hal yang lebih besar dan lebih baik?
Hapus nilai bidang Access dengan sangat hati-hati
Setiap kali Anda menghapus nilai bidang dari tabel, pastikan Anda mematikan nilai di catatan yang benar — periksa lagi, dan lalu hanya jika Anda yakin, hapus yang asli. Meski begitu, Anda masih dapat melakukan Ctrl+Z cepat dan memulihkan item yang menyinggung asalkan Anda membatalkannya segera setelah mengetahui kesalahannya.Mengapa semua pengecekan dan pengecekan ulang? Karena setelah Anda menghapus nilai bidang dan melakukan hal lain dalam tabel, Access benar-benar melupakan nilai lama Anda. Itu hilang, seolah-olah itu tidak pernah ada. Jika Anda menghapus rekaman dari tabel, rekaman tersebut benar-benar hilang — karena tidak ada Pembatalan yang tersedia untuk seluruh rekaman. Jika catatan itu penting dan Anda tidak memiliki file cadangan saat ini ketika catatan itu hilang, Anda kurang beruntung. Maaf!
Cadangkan, cadangkan, cadangkan database Access Anda
Apakah saya membuatnya cukup jelas? Selalu simpan cadangan pekerjaan Anda! Tidak ada pengganti untuk cadangan data Anda saat ini — terutama jika data tersebut penting untuk kehidupan pribadi atau profesional Anda. Strategi yang efektif sering kali mencakup pemeliharaan salinan cadangan di lokasi lain jika bencana menghancurkan kantor Anda, baik itu di kantor lain atau di cloud.
Jika Anda berpikir bahwa Anda tidak pernah membutuhkan cadangan sebelumnya, jadi mengapa repot-repot, pikirkan tentang banjir. Pikirkan tentang penyiar berita yang mengatakan bahwa daerah yang saat ini berada di bawah air belum pernah banjir sebelumnya. Bayangkan kehidupan orang-orang mengambang di jalan. Apakah Anda sedang menghadapi bencana nyata dari proporsi badai, kebakaran, atau hard drive komputer Anda memutuskan untuk mati (dan itu memang terjadi — bahkan jika itu belum pernah terjadi pada Anda sebelumnya), Anda akan jauh lebih bahagia jika Anda memiliki cadangan database Anda.
Pikirkan, pikirkan, dan pikirkan lagi sebelum mengambil tindakan di Access
Anda tahu slogan tukang kayu, “Ukur dua kali, potong sekali”? Hal yang sama dapat dikatakan untuk berpikir ketika datang ke database Anda. Jangan hanya memikirkan sesuatu, mengambil kesimpulan cepat, dan kemudian menyelami. Tunggu, pikirkan lagi, dan kemudian mungkin memikirkannya untuk ketiga kalinya. Lalu menarik kesimpulan dan mulai bertindak berdasarkan itu. Dengan semua kekuatan yang diberikan Access kepada Anda, ditambah dengan kemampuan untuk menyimpan ribuan catatan dalam database Anda, kesalahan yang relatif sederhana bisa sangat mahal karena potensi konsekuensi dalam hal kehilangan data atau tindakan "tidak dapat dibatalkan" yang diambil dalam kesalahan.Terorganisir dan tetap teratur saat bekerja di Access
Meskipun saran untuk mengatur dan membuatnya tetap sederhana mungkin tampak bertentangan, kedua nasihat ini benar-benar cocok. Menjaga hal-hal sederhana seringkali dapat menjadi cara untuk menghindari kebutuhan akan banyak organisasi setelah fakta. Padahal Anda mungkin bosan mendengar orang tua mengingatkan Anda bahwa “ada tempat untuk segala sesuatu, dan segala sesuatu ada pada tempatnya” (atau jika mereka kurang puitis, “Bersihkan kamarmu!!! ”), mereka benar.
Jika Anda mengatur database Anda, Anda akan menghemat waktu dan kesedihan. Tabel yang terencana dengan baik akan lebih mudah untuk kueri, laporan, dan sertakan dalam formulir. Ini juga akan mengurutkan dan memfilter seperti kilat.
Ya, Anda bisa terlalu terorganisir. Faktanya, mengatur secara berlebihan sama sekali terlalu mudah. Redakan keinginan Anda untuk berorganisasi dengan menumbuhkan gairah lain:bekerja dengan langkah sesedikit mungkin. Batasi jumlah folder dan subfolder yang Anda gunakan — maksimal lima tingkat folder sudah lebih dari cukup untuk siapa saja. Jika Anda melampaui lima tingkat, organisasi Anda mulai menabrak produktivitas Anda (dan tidak ada yang menyukai hilangnya produktivitas, apalagi orang-orang yang datang dengan slogan-slogan kecil yang konyol untuk poster-poster perasaan senang perusahaan).